ATI 6.8 pre-release
This is the long awaited radeon driver with randr 1.2 support.
radeon 6.7 was pretty much a dead end, so it's been branched for those that
still want to play with it. In addition to randr support there are quite a
few other goodies: zero copy tfp, improved connector table parsing, TV-out
support, and much more.

This is pre-release of the ATI driver aimed at 7.3. It doesn't contain randr1.2
support it does however contain a major re-write of the output mappings from
what was known as Alex's superpatch. Please logs all regressions into bugzilla
so we can fix them before the 6.7 release.
